I set my sights on making an Olympic team, not realizing how tough it was going to be.
Interpretation
The quote reflects the determination to achieve ambitious goals, despite underestimating the challenges ahead.
Jackie Joyner-Kersee's quote emphasizes the importance of setting high aspirations, such as making an Olympic team, while also acknowledging that one may not fully grasp the difficulties involved in pursuing such lofty objectives. It highlights a common experience where enthusiasm and ambition might overshadow the reality of the hard work and perseverance required to overcome obstacles in the journey toward success.
